Around 30 Rounded Up In Area Drug Dragnet

(BRAZIL) - About 30 people are facing charges in connection with a five-county drug sweep centered in western Indiana.

Dozens of officers took part in the sweep, with most of the arrests made in Clay County. All of the arrests Tuesday took place without incident.

Clay County Sheriff Mike Heaton says most of the arrests were for dealing methamphetamines, but marijuana and prescription drugs were also involved. He says authorities tried to serve about 40 arrest warrants -- and more arrests were expected.

Warrants also were issued for people living in Vigo, Parke, Hendricks and Monroe Counties.

Clay County Prosecutor Lee Reberger says the sweep was the result of a two-year long covert drug investigation which began with information gathered during a large drug sweep in 2006.
